Health Bill Faces Delay as Democrats Tinker With Cost
March 17 (Bloomberg) — Congressional Democrats, racing to finish work on an overhaul of the U.S. health system, are facing delays as they strive to meet deficit-cutting targets.
The Democrats, who had expected a final cost estimate from the Congressional Budget Office as early as last week, must show that a bill amending legislation the Senate passed in December will reduce the federal budget deficit by $2 billion over the first five years and not add to the shortfall afterward.
